    Early Life and Childhood

    Eminem's early life was marked by financial struggles and a tumultuous family environment. His parents, Marshall Bruce Mathers Jr. and Deborah Rae Nelson, divorced when he was just six months old. Eminem's mother raised him and his older brother, Nathan, in a low-income household. They frequently moved between Missouri and Michigan, which made it difficult for Eminem to form stable relationships during his childhood.

    Despite these challenges, Eminem discovered his passion for music at a young age. He began rapping at the age of 14 and quickly realized that it was a way for him to express his emotions and escape the hardships of his life.     Musical Influences in His Youth

    Eminem was heavily influenced by artists such as LL Cool J, Run-D.M.C., and the Beastie Boys. These artists shaped his understanding of rap and inspired him to develop his own unique style. His early exposure to hip-hop laid the foundation for his future success.

    Musical Journey and Career Highlights

    Eminem's musical journey began in the underground rap scene of Detroit. He gained recognition for his exceptional lyrical skills and released his debut album, "Infinite," in 1996. However, it was his second album, "The Slim Shady LP," released in 1999, that catapulted him to international fame. The album featured hits like "My Name Is" and "Guilty Conscience," which showcased Eminem's ability to blend humor with dark storytelling.

  • Over the years, Eminem has released several critically acclaimed albums, including:

    • The Marshall Mathers LP (2000): Known for tracks like "The Real Slim Shady" and "Stan," this album solidified Eminem's status as a global superstar.
    • The Eminem Show (2002): Featuring hits like "Without Me" and "Cleanin' Out My Closet," this album explored themes of fame and personal struggles.
    • Recovery (2010): A deeply personal album that addressed Eminem's battles with addiction and his journey to recovery.

    Collaborations and Influence

    Eminem has collaborated with numerous artists, including Dr. Dre, Rihanna, and 50 Cent. His work with Dr. Dre, in particular, played a pivotal role in shaping his career. Together, they co-founded Shady Records, which has been instrumental in launching the careers of several successful artists.

    Personal Life and Relationships

    Eminem's personal life has been as complex and tumultuous as his music. He married Kimberly Anne Scott in 1999, but their relationship was fraught with challenges, leading to multiple separations and reconciliations. They eventually divorced in 2001, but their bond remains evident in Eminem's music, as many of his songs explore themes of love, heartbreak, and regret.

    Eminem has one daughter, Hailie Jade Scott Mathers, born on December 25, 1995. Hailie has been a constant source of inspiration for Eminem, and he often references her in his lyrics. His devotion to his daughter is evident in songs like "Hailie's Song" and "When I'm Gone."

    Awards and Achievements

    Eminem's contributions to the music industry have been recognized with numerous awards and accolades. Some of his most notable achievements include:

    • 15 Grammy Awards
    • An Academy Award for Best Original Song ("Lose Yourself" from the film 8 Mile)
    • Over 220 million records sold worldwide, making him one of the best-selling music artists of all time
    • Induction into the Rock and Roll Hall of Fame in 2022

    Philanthropy and Social Impact

    Beyond his music, Eminem has made significant contributions to philanthropy and social causes. He has donated millions of dollars to organizations that support at-risk youth, education, and disaster relief. Eminem's Marshall Mathers Foundation focuses on helping disadvantaged children and families in Detroit, his hometown.
